Rare Standards include premium construction practices and features that many builders consider upgrades. These include:
- Insulated Concrete Form (ICF) construction
- Hydronic in-floor heating
- European tilt-and-turn windows
- Open-web floor systems
- Premium mechanical systems
- Custom millwork
- Luxury appliance packages
- Solar panels
- Thoughtfully designed architectural details that enhance both performance and everyday living
For homeowners, these standards translate into superior construction, improved soundproofing, greater energy efficiency, better-designed living spaces, and a more durable home overall.

What’s one piece of advice you’d give someone buying a new home today?
Look beyond finishes and floor plans. Ask how the home is built, what materials are used, how the builder communicates throughout the process, and what support you’ll receive after possession. Those details make all the difference in the years to come.
